Histological endpoints in this field are scored on biopsy: resolution of steatohepatitis without worsening of fibrosis, or improvement in fibrosis without worsening of steatohepatitis. Both are harder to achieve and to interpret than an imaging surrogate.

A token symbol identifies an asset, not a network. The same symbol commonly exists on several chains with incompatible address formats, and sending across that boundary is generally unrecoverable.

Confirmations are the count of blocks built on top of the one containing your transaction. Until there are some, the transaction is not settled in any meaningful sense.

Intention-to-treat analyses everybody randomised regardless of what they did afterwards. Completer analyses only those who finished. The second is systematically more flattering and both are legitimate if labelled.

Adding more water does not change how much peptide is in the vial. It changes the concentration, which changes the volume you draw for the same amount. That is the entire relationship.
